摘要

This study presents the design of an overseas practicum project in the early stage of preservice teacher education as a strategy to promote teacher candidates’ professional development in teaching knowledge. A five-month practicum that provided both mock-up training via cloud platforms and 15-day residential experience at a Taiwanese overseas school in China was developed and implemented in 2017 and 2018. An iterative action research approach was designed with multifaceted data collection, analyses, and triangulations, to evaluate the effectiveness and student satisfaction of the programme. Results are presented and discussed following the order of programme phases to suggest the design of the overseas pre-service practicum regarding developing teaching knowledge via various phases.
